Determining Common Door Issues
Before diving into the repair process, it's necessary to identify the particular issues your door is dealing with. Here are some typical problems and their symptoms:
Sticking or Binding Doors
Symptoms: The door is tough to open or close, or it does not latch appropriately.Causes: Warping, misalignment, or inflamed wood.
Gaps Around the Door
Symptoms: Drafts, cold air, or light coming through the spaces.Causes: Loose or damaged weatherstripping, gaps in the frame.
Loose or Damaged Hinges

Broken Locks or Latches
Signs: The door will not lock, or the lock is stuck.Causes: Worn-out systems, damaged elements, or improper installation.
Cracked or Damaged Panels

The expense of door repairs can differ extensively depending upon the level of the damage and the materials needed. Here's a breakdown of common costs for different repairs:
Sticking or Binding Doors
Materials Needed: Wood filler, sandpaper, lube.Expense: ₤ 5 - ₤ 20.Labor: DIY (free) or professional (₤ 50 - ₤ 100).
Gaps Around the Door
Products Needed: Weatherstripping, caulk.Cost: ₤ 10 - ₤ 50.Labor: DIY (complimentary) or professional (₤ 50 - ₤ 100).
Loose or Damaged Hinges
Materials Needed: New screws, lubricant, replacement hinges.Cost: ₤ 10 - ₤ 30.Labor: DIY (free) or professional (₤ 50 - ₤ 100).
Broken Locks or Latches
Materials Needed: New lock or lock system.Cost: ₤ 20 - ₤ 100.Labor: DIY (complimentary) or professional (₤ 100 - ₤ 200).
Split or Damaged Panels

Spaces Around the Door
Action 1: Remove old weatherstripping or caulk.Step 2: Measure the gaps and cut the new weatherstripping to size.Step 3: Install the weatherstripping along the spaces.Step 4: Apply caulk to any remaining spaces for a seal.
Loose or Damaged Hinges
Step 1: Remove the old screws and clean the hinge holes.Step 2: Use longer screws to secure the hinges more securely.Step 3: Apply a lube to the hinges to lower noise.Step 4: If essential, change the hinges with new ones.
Broken Locks or Latches
Action 1: Remove the old lock or lock mechanism.Step 2: Measure the measurements of the new system.Step 3: Install the brand-new lock or latch, guaranteeing it is aligned properly.Step 4: Test the lock to guarantee it operates appropriately.
Broken or Damaged Panels

Q: Can I repair a door myself, or should I hire a professional?
A: Many door repairs can be managed DIY, specifically for small issues like sticking doors or spaces. However, for more complex issues like broken locks or extensive damage, working with a professional may be more cost-effective and make sure a correct repair.
Q: How typically should I check my doors for maintenance?
A: It's a good idea to check your doors at least when a year for signs of wear and tear. Regular maintenance can help avoid little concerns from becoming major issues.

Q: Can I utilize any type of wood filler for door repairs?
A: It's best to use a wood filler that is specifically developed for the type of wood your door is made from. This will make sure a better match and a more durable repair.
Q: How can I tell if my door is beyond repair and needs replacement?
